People are wading through flooded roads in Kathmandu, Nepal, on August 6, 2024. Nepal's Meteorological Forecasting Division (MFD) under the Department of Hydrology and Meteorology (DHM) is issuing a red alert in over three dozen districts which are likely to be highly affected. Currently, Nepal is experiencing the influence of a westerly low-pressure system combined with local winds. (Photo by Subaas Shrestha/NurPhoto)
